Shop
Showing 1105–1120 of 3096 resultsSorted by latest
-
Original price was: $25.90.$23.00Current price is: $23.00.
-
Original price was: $25.90.$23.00Current price is: $23.00.
-
Original price was: $25.90.$23.00Current price is: $23.00.
-
Original price was: $25.90.$23.00Current price is: $23.00.
-
Original price was: $25.90.$23.00Current price is: $23.00.
Showing 1105–1120 of 3096 resultsSorted by latest